India has imported 3.72 million tonnes (provisional) of finished steel during April-August 2024-25 as compared to 2.78 million tonnes in April-August 2023-24, i.e. up by 33.9%. Furthermore, production of finished steel increased 5.4% to 58.92 million tonnes in April-August 2024-25 as compared to 55.91 million tonnes during the corresponding period of last year.
Meanwhile, export of finished steel declined 39.6% to 1.91 million tonnes in April-August 2024-25 as against 3.17 million tonnes in April-August 2023-24. Finished steel consumption has registered a growth of 13% to 60.27 million tonnes in April-August 2024-25 as compared to 52.95 million tonnes during the corresponding period of last year.
India is the world’s second largest crude steel producer with production of 144.3 million tonnes crude steel in FY 2023-24. India was net importer of finished steel during 2023-24 with export of 7.49 million tonnes and import of 8.32 million tonnes. During the current financial year i.e. April-October 2024-25 (provisional), import and export of finished steel was 5.77 million tonnes and 2.75 million tonnes, respectively.
